Mahershala Ali Still Attached to Marvel’s Blade as Key Cast Members Exit Amid Production Delays

Questions continue to circulate regarding Mahershala Ali status in Marvel’s Blade movie, as the film faces repeated production hurdles and the departure of several significant cast members. Once slated for release in November 2023, the project now hangs in uncertainty as script rewrites, directorial changes, and the shifting commitments of actors challenge its future.

Casting Changes and Departures Impact Blade’s Progress

Announced to great anticipation at San Diego Comic-Con in 2019, Marvel’s Blade movie has faced an uphill battle. Multiple setbacks have forced Marvel Studios to push the release window to 2025. Throughout these delays, the cast list has notably changed, with key departures shaking fan expectations.

Aaron Pierre, originally announced when Bassam Tariq was attached as director, decided to exit the project as it evolved into a new direction. His role was never made public, adding to the speculation around the film’s creative direction. Delroy Lindo, another early addition to the ensemble, also confirmed his exit. Speaking about his experience, Lindo told Entertainment Weekly:

And in the various conversations I had with producers, the writer, the director at the time, it was all leading into being very inclusive. It was really exciting conceptually, but it was also exciting in terms of the character that was going to form. And then, for whatever reason, it just went off the rails.

—Delroy Lindo, Actor

Meanwhile, Mia Goth, who had been set to portray the villain Lillith, has taken on a new project in the Star Wars universe. Despite her commitments elsewhere, she officially remains part of Blade. The film’s development path has also seen a director change, as Bassam Tariq left and Yann Demange, known for his work on Lovecraft Country, was chosen to helm the feature. Eric Pearson is the latest screenwriter to take on the script as Marvel Studios attempts to restructure the story.

Mahershala Ali’s Commitment Remains Firm as Production Continues

Despite the growing uncertainty and the departure of fellow cast members, Mahershala Ali remains attached to the Blade reboot, affirming his commitment to the title role. Mia Goth, though involved in other projects, continues her association with the film. The combination of directorial and script changes, paired with cast reshuffling, has led to the removal of Blade from this year’s release schedule.

Marvel Studios, producers, and those involved in ongoing conversations—including writers like Eric Pearson and new director Yann Demange—are under pressure to navigate these challenges and deliver a project that meets fan expectations.
